The complexity of a truck accident compensation claim

Truck accidents can be complicated because of the massive and heavy trucks's size. This can result in serious injuries that will require costly and long-term medical attention. As a result, an injured victim of a collision with a truck may require greater compensation for the damages incurred. In most cases, truck accidents involve multiple victims and vehicles that can complicate the claims process.

Truck accident compensation claims are more complex than passenger vehicle accidents because there are more parties that can be held accountable. The truck accident law driver may have been operating beyond the hours allowed or could be fatigued at the time of the accident. If the driver of the truck was given financial incentives to break the law, the owner of the trailer could also be held accountable. The cargo loader could be held accountable if a tractor-trailer wasn't secured properly or improperly loaded.

In addition to the financial burdens related to truck accidents many victims are confronted with emotional and psychological trauma. Traumatic injuries can leave scars or disfigurement. In certain instances victims can suffer brain damage. These brain injuries can have a major impact on the life of the victim. In these cases the victim could be entitled to non-economic damages to compensate for their emotional and psychological suffering.

Damages that a jury awards in the case of a truck accident compensation claim

In a truck accident compensation claim the amount of damages is determined on a myriad of factors. Certain damages are simple to calculate, such as lost wages or medical bills however, others are difficult to quantify. For instance, a jury may consider the effects of pain and suffering scarring, disfigurement, or other losses that are not economic in deciding how much the plaintiff is entitled to compensation. The jury will also look at the impact of injuries on plaintiff's quality-of-life.
